Do you offer a carafe house wine

Carol Miller | Sep 14, 2018 | Category: Italian restaurant

Capri Restaurant - All questions

Address: 935 N Krome Ave, Florida City, FL 33034, USA

Chuck | Sep 14, 2018

They have red and white house wine. By the glass, and carafe.

Michael Morrison | Sep 14, 2018

Yes

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

Trending Places